WarCollar has an opportunity for a DOC Technician supporting a mission‑focused contract. This senior‑level role is ideal for an experienced engineer with deep expertise in CNO/CNE systems who can architect, integrate, and sustain advanced cyber capabilities across complex operational environments. You will lead system engineering efforts, design and maintain mission systems, collaborate with developers and operators, and ensure technical readiness for cyber operations.
The role requires a Top Secret (TS) level clearance.
This is on a funded contract, bidding on a specific Task Order.
,
Required Skills
The Senior System Engineer will have a minimum of five (5 ) years of experience in CNO/CNE engineering, including:
- Experience designing, integrating, and maintaining mission systems supporting cyber operations
- Strong understanding of system architecture, OS internals, and network protocols
- Experience with Windows, Linux, and mobile platforms
- Ability to perform system‑level troubleshooting, debugging, and performance analysis
- Familiarity with virtualization, containerization, and distributed systems
- Experience supporting capability deployment, sustainment, and lifecycle management
- Ability to lead technical discussions and mentor junior engineers
- Strong analytical and problem solving skills
